> - NeXT/Apple runtime is known/believed to perform better than GNU 
> runtime.

Hmmm.  Do you have benchmarks ?  I'd be interested in them if you have.

I thought this was a confused matter open to discussion, with pros and
cons on each side.

But the Apple runtime performs better on class method invocations - that's
a fact (I hoped to have the time to fill the gap at some point, but I
never found that time <wishful sigh>).  The GNU runtime has typed
selectors though, and it's more portable.
